Friday, September 11, 2009

Did You Know?

In the Middle Ages, beavers were hunted for their testicles which were believed to have medicinal properties. There are a ton of manuscripts depicting beavers biting off their own testicles in order to escape the clutches of hunters. Here are two particularly awesome (and graphic) pictures of it. Enjoy.

No comments: